For many of the UK’s small manufacturers, the road to success is often a tough one. Limited resources, high competition, rising costs, and the constant pressure to keep up with industry changes make it a real challenge to thrive in todayโ€™s market. For many, itโ€™s not just about improving efficiency anymore โ€” itโ€™s about making smarter decisions that help ensure long-term survival and growth. However, with all these hurdles, many small businesses struggle to gain clarity on how to truly improve their operations and plan for the future.

The problem is simple yet widespread: small manufacturers often lack the strategic insight they need to make the right decisions. Many are caught up in the cycle of short-term fixes โ€” focusing on keeping costs low, staying competitive, and meeting immediate production goals โ€” but without a clear understanding of whatโ€™s working and whatโ€™s not, it becomes difficult to break out of that cycle and create real, lasting improvements.

And thatโ€™s where the bigger issues come in. Without proper data-driven insights into their operations, many small manufacturers unknowingly leave critical opportunities on the table, missing out on chances to:

  • Identify inefficiencies and bottlenecks that slow down production
  • Optimize workforce management, ensuring the right skills are in place
  • Keep up with technological changes, ensuring they donโ€™t fall behind competitors
  • Plan for sustainable growth, aligning their operations with future market trends

While itโ€™s easy to get caught up in the daily grind, the failure to address these strategic gaps can prevent small businesses from reaching their full potential.
